Skytrex Adventure is nestled within the lush Shah Alam Agricultural Park where you can indulge in rope climbing and flying fox away from the hustle and bustle of city life. Located just 40 km from Kuala Lumpur, this theme park offers adrenaline junkies three types of challenges with varying level of difficulties. For those just starting out, the Little Adventure offers various obstacle courses starting from the Ladder Up before ending with Flying Fox across a huge lake. For the intermediate level, the Big Thrill offers a zig-zagging obstacle course that starts with the Ladder Up before ending with the Fishermen Net Exit. For the advanced level, the Extreme Challenge will test your endurance limit by first crossing over a lake via the Flying Fox followed by various obstacles before ending again with the Flying Fox at the exit point. Skytrex is constructed and managed in accordance with international safety standards to ensure your safety. Ticket prices range from RM35 to RM60. Skytrex Adventure also provides corporate team building packages priced from RM189 per person. Be sure to make your reservations early.

Jump Street Asia is Malaysia’s first indoor trampoline park located in Seksyen 13 Petaling Jaya. Situated some 10 km drive away from the Kuala Lumpur’s city centre, this is where you can revel in jumping on trampolines. There are three main attractions that can be found here – The Main Court, The Foam Pit and The Wall. The Main Court is ideal for all jumpers of all ages and skill levels. Offering 9,000 sq ft of interconnected trampolines extending right up the walls, this is where you can put those skate-boarding stunts and parkour moves to practice before hitting the road. For those who want to fly high but with a soft landing, then look no more than The Foam Pit. As its name suggests, this is where you can unleash your inner gymnast while landing on soft cube foams to cushion your fall. For those who prefer group activities, the Dodgeball will test your balance, reflexes and strength when dodging and jumping on trampolines. Tickets are priced at RM27 per hour (including GST).

Berjaya Times Square Theme Park is located inside one of Kuala Lumpur’s renowned shopping mall, Berjaya Times Square. Located at the 5th & 7th floor, this theme park is the largest indoor theme park of its kind in Malaysia offering around 133, 000 sq ft of endless fun and excitement for all ages. Offering over six and eight rides at the Fantasy Garden and Galaxy Station respectively, you will be spoilt for choice ranging from the Safari Jeep at the Botanic Drive to a spinning good time at the Dizzy Izzy. Ticket prices costs RM60 and RM50 for adults and kids respectively. For cost savings, go for the family package starting from RM113.

Dubbed “Asia’s Largest Indoor Trampoline Extreme Park”, Enerz offers over 80,000 sq ft of jumping space with a wide range of activities that are suited for all ages. The main action happens at The Extreme Park with eight different attractions to choose from – Trampoline Park, Wall Climbing, Gut Builder, Dodgeball, Ninja Warrior, Meltdown, Gladiator and Sky Ropes. From jumping on trampolines to obstacle course to build your child’s self-confidence, Enerz ensures hours of endless entertainment for the entire family while giving your mind and body a total workout. That’s not all. There are also corporate packages via its Enerz Team Building Programme to build camaraderie among office colleagues.
